Getting Started

To begin your mining journey, you'll need some essential items:

  1. Pickaxe: The most crucial tool for mining. As a beginner, start with a Bronze pickaxe. Upgrade to higher-tier pickaxes as you level up.
  2. Essential Quests: Completing certain quests like Doric's Quest, The Dig Site, and The Giant Dwarf can grant you early Mining experience and unlock new areas.

Rock Types and Locations

Throughout Gielinor, you'll find various types of rocks that yield different ores. Here are some commonly mined rocks and their locations:

  1. Tin and Copper: These ores can be found in the Lumbridge Swamp, Varrock, and Rimmington.
  2. Iron: Look for iron rocks in Al Kharid, Mining Guild, and Falador.
  3. Coal: This valuable ore can be mined in places like Mining Guild, Fossil Island, and Keldagrim.
  4. Gold: Mine gold rocks in Crafting Guild, Arzinian Mine, and Brimhaven.
  5. Mithril: Search for mithril rocks in Falador, Yanille, and Arzinian Mine.
  6. Adamantite: These rocks can be found in the Mining Guild, Karamja Volcano, and Arzinian Mine.
  7. Runite: The rarest and most valuable ore, located in the Heroes' Guild Mine, Karamja Volcano, and Wilderness.

Levelling Methods

  1. Levels 1-15: Begin by mining copper and tin rocks in the Lumbridge Swamp or Varrock. Bank the ores for later use or sell them to make some gold.

    • XP Rates: Approximately 5000 XP per hour.
  2. Levels 15-30: Transition to mining iron rocks in Al Kharid or the Mining Guild. Continue banking the ores for later use or profit.

    • XP Rates: Around 15,000 XP per hour.
  3. Levels 30-55: Focus on mining coal at locations like the Mining Guild, Fossil Island, or Keldagrim.

    • XP Rates: Expect around 25,000 XP per hour.
  4. Levels 55-70: Switch to mining mithril ores in Falador, Yanille, or Arzinian Mine.

    • XP Rates: Approximately 35,000 XP per hour.
  5. Levels 70-85: Start mining adamantite rocks, preferably in the Mining Guild or Karamja Volcano.

    • XP Rates: Anticipate around 40,000 XP per hour.
  6. Levels 85-99: The pinnacle of your mining journey! Mine runite ores located in the Heroes' Guild Mine, Karamja Volcano, or Wilderness.

    • XP Rates: Around 45,000 XP per hour.

Additional Tips

  1. Mining Guild: Accessible with level 60 Mining, the Mining Guild offers numerous rocks of various types. It's an ideal location for leveling up your mining skill.
  2. Rockertunities: Pay attention to the game messages while mining. Occasionally, you'll receive rockertunities that provide bonus XP when successfully mined.
  3. Mining Outfit: Obtain the Prospector's outfit from the Motherlode Mine or purchase it with nuggets earned from the MLM shop. This outfit grants a Mining experience boost.
  4. Blast Mining: Once you reach level 75 Mining, you can try your hand at Blast Mining in Lovakengj. It provides an alternative method to train your Mining skill.
